The OP didn't specify if the TV was connected to the receiver via optical which may have reduced to sound to DD 2.0. Having a 5.1 AVR can provide a noticeable difference between 5.1 and 2.0. My TV doesn't support DD+ but will pass DD 5.1. A lot depends how the audio is supplied by the content also.
